SOS has immediate openings for Loss Prevention (Unarmed) Security Officers in Austin/San Marcos

Loss Prevention Secuirty Officers are front and center to represent the best of the best to our clients! Officers are held to a higher standard, and represent a level of excellence. Officer's will be trained at multiple sites in Austin and San Marcos and relied upon to cover shifts when needed. Flexibility is the key element, needs could arise morning, noon, or night! Loss Prevention Officers are the eyes and ears of our client sites to safeguard people, property, and assets. The skills needed are critical thinking, observation, impeccable communication both oral and written, attention to detail, and overall professional security presence to detect and deter loss or damage of client property. If you have the experience and can demonstrate pride, determination, and professionalism, being a Loss Prevention Officer is for you!

Education, License, and Certification Requirements:

High School Diploma or GED

Valid TX Security License Required

Valid CPR and AED certivfication

Qualifications:

Should be at least 18 years of age or older as required by applicable law

Required to be authorized to work in the United States

A valid driver’s license with clean driving history required, (only for jobs with car)

Must have a minimum of three years Loss Prevention experience

Must be able to pass a background check

Must be able to pass a drug screening

Valid CPR, AED training certificate


Requirements:

Must be authorized to work in the United States

With or without reasonable accommodation, the physical and mental requirements of this job may include the following: seeing, hearing, speaking, and writing clearly. Occasional reaching with hands and arms, stooping, kneeling, crouching and crawling. Frequent sitting, standing and walking, which may be required for long periods of time, and may involve climbing stairs and walking up inclines and on uneven terrain. Additional physical requirements may include, frequent lifting and/or moving up to 10 pounds and occasional lifting and/or moving up to 25 pounds.

Must be able to meet and continue to meet any applicable state, county and municipal licensing requirements for Security Officers
